加密你的etcd凭据:Kubernetes安全的关键步骤
💡
原文英文,约700词,阅读约需3分钟。
📝
内容提要
加密etcd凭据是保护Kubernetes集群的关键步骤,etcd是Kubernetes核心的键值存储,包含集群状态、机密信息和配置。需实施数据加密、限制访问和使用工具如Vault、KMS和Kubernetes本地加密。
🎯
关键要点
- 加密etcd凭据是保护Kubernetes集群的关键步骤。
- etcd是Kubernetes核心的键值存储,包含集群状态、机密信息和配置。
- 未加密的etcd可能成为基础设施的单点故障。
- 数据静态加密是云原生环境中的基本安全实践。
- Kubernetes支持静态加密,确保即使存储被破坏,数据仍然不可读。
- 创建加密配置文件并定期旋转加密密钥是保护数据的有效方法。
- 基于角色的访问控制(RBAC)可以管理对etcd数据的访问权限。
- RBAC确保只有授权用户可以访问etcd数据库,降低意外或恶意更改的可能性。
- Kubernetes原生加密、HashiCorp Vault、Google Cloud KMS和AWS KMS等工具可以增强etcd的安全性。
- 加密etcd是Kubernetes安全的必要措施,必须实施数据加密、限制访问和使用安全工具。
🏷️
标签
➡️